Course content

Based on the method of Problem-based learning (PBL), the course “Cases in International Marketing” aims at acquainting students with real-life scenarios from the field of international marketing and communication. By confronting cross-cultural issues from the world of doing business course participants are expected to get a grasp of how marketing theories and models are implemented in real-life situations. Through the completion of a written case report task students are also expected to further develop their analytical thinking and writing skills as well as to get an insight into the development of marketing strategies and implementation plans.

Topics

  • Emerging Markets
  • Uncertain Environments
  • International Marketing Strategies
  • Assessing the International Environment
  • Local Competition
  • International Market Research Basics: Voice of the International Consumer Studies
  • International Market Segmentation Techniques
  • etc.
